Nanjing Museum of Paleontology

The Nanjing Museum of Paleontology contains a collection of prehistoric fossils from around China. One of their most prized possessions is the world’s oldest fossil flower while their most awe-inspiring item is a fossilized Mamenchisaurus skeleton. Mamenchisaurus is reported to have the longest neck of any land animal that has ever lived.
A downside for foreigners is that almost all signs are only written in Chinese.

Stegosaurus
The Museum is right in front of Jiming Temple ( 鸡鸣寺 ) and just off of Beijing Dong Lu (北京东路).
To get there by bus take route 2, 3, 11, 15, 20, 24, 31, 44, 48, 52, 70, 304 or travel 1 to one of the Jiming Temple bus stops. Note that the museum is not right on Beijing Dong Lu, but you actually have to walk about 15 meters north to get there.

The 186 hectare Nanjing Botanical Garden is a fine place to escape the crowds of Nanjing city. Inside the garden are 100s of Bonsai trees, roses, a greenhouse with cacti, succulents and foliage plants, 10 meter tall Magnolia trees and many other types of plants.

Bridge World
Totally unrelated to the theme of the rest of the park, included inside the gardens is a place called 桥世界 (Qiao Shijie) which translates into "Bridge World". It includes a series of obstacle bridges. During weekdays it receives very few visitors, but it is still staffed and well-maintained. There is no additional fee to enter Bridge World, but for an extra 5 yuan you can ride a bamboo raft in the pond.
How to Get There:
Tourist bus #3 (游3) as well as bus numbers 20w and 315w stop at the entrance. Taxis pass by occasionally but are not nearly as plentiful as they are in the city.

Nanjing Railway Station (南京火车站)
The majority of passenger train traffic coming in and out of Nanjing runs through Nanjing Railway Station. From Nanjing Station it is possible to travel in any direction within China to cities including Beijing, Shangahi, Xi’An and Guangzhou to name a few. The station itself is new, spacious and conveniently located just north of Xuanwu Lake and on a subway line. Click here to see the map.

Ming Tomb (Admission: FreeCNY) - Nanjing became the capital of China when Zhu Yuanzhang founded the Ming Dynasty in 1368. During his reign, Zhu Yuanzhang built the great city walls of Nanjing, the imperial palace, and his future tomb - the Ming Tomb in Nanjing. The Ming Tomb is a certified UNESCO World Heritage Site and is a must-see for travellers to Nanjing.
Xuanwu Lake (Admission: Free) - Close to the city center and featuring 368 hectares of water and 104 hectares of land, Xuanwu Lake Park is a favorite getaway for locals. Well before the sunrise and even after sunset, the park is bustling with visitors. Some come to walk, jog, or fly kites, others to practice Tai Chi, and many more just want to enjoy the scenery.

City Wall (Admission: 45CNY) - Nanjing City Wall, constructed during the Yuan and Ming Dynasties between 1365 and 1386, originally stretched over 30km which made it the longest city wall in the world. Now, with about two thirds of the wall still intact it still remains the longest city wall in China. We could walk on the city wall and feel the history of Nanjing.
